In his writing, he concerns himself with the Irish middle class and the struggles many face trying to understand the relevance of traditional national identity. Bolger’s characters often mirror his desire for a more inclusive society. His plays have earned him a number of awards, including the Oxford Samuel Beckett Theatre Trust Award for Best Debut Play, an Edinburgh Festival Scotsman Fringe First Award, and the \u003ci\u003eIrish Times\u003c\/i\u003e\/ESB Prize for Best New Irish Play in 2004.","brand":"Vintage","offers":[{"title":"Default Title","offer_id":46303626232037,"sku":"NP9780679765462","price":18.0,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":false}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/1842\/7735\/files\/9780679765462.jpg?v=1767742087","url":"https:\/\/k12savings.com\/products\/the-vintage-book-of-contemporary-irish-fiction-isbn-9780679765462","provider":"K12savings","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
